Southwest credit card refer-a-friend bonuses are back, with a chance to earn up to 100,000 bonus points. Chase, issuer of the co-branded Southwest cards, is awarding 20,000 bonus points for each approval when you refer others to Southwest’s personal or business credit cards. The bonus points are only available once the referred applicant is approved.

The Southwest family of cards is part of Chase’s refer-a-friend program. Here’s how the program works.

How to refer a friend to a Southwest credit card

Go to chase.com/referafriend/swafamily to find the referral offer. Input your last name, zip code and the last four digits of your credit card, then click the “Continue” button.

Then you will be able to send your friends a referral email or provide them with your unique referral link. You can also refer friends through Chase’s mobile app, which is available on the App Store and Google Play. You will receive bonus points if your friends are approved for a card.

How long does it take to get Southwest bonus points?

The points should post to your account within eight weeks after your friend is approved. These bonus points accelerate your earnings to get award flights and possibly the coveted Southwest Companion Pass, which allows a buddy to fly with you for only the price of taxes and fees.

If you were to max out your friend referrals for the year, the 100,000 bonus points you’d receive would get you almost to the 135,000 Rapid Rewards points you need for a Southwest Companion Pass.
